InRule

InRule provides software and services that enable subject matter experts automate business rules and configure the behavior of applications without programming effort and risk. We make decision logic, rules and calculations transparent and easy to change, allowing experts to own them and providing IT with APIs and tooling to support customizations and production processes. Since 2002, InRule has been deployed in more than 40 countries by hundreds of organizations in the commercial and public sectors. Numerous partners and OEM clients have integrated InRule into their products, from lending and insurance, to risk management and embedded devices. InRules products are cloud-ready, and run on mobile to integrate with popular cloud-CRM products. InRule was founded by CEO Rik Chomko and CTO Loren Goodman with a vision for delivering the power of computing without the complexity of programming. InRule is headquartered in Chicago.

Zimbra

Zimbra powers collaboration for the way you work. Zimbra connects people and information with unified collaboration software that includes email, calendaring, file sharing, activity streams, social communities and more. With technology designed for social, mobile and the cloud, Zimbra gives individuals the flexibility to work from virtually anywhere, through nearly every computer, tablet and mobile device.   Zimbra is trusted by more than 5,000 companies, service providers and government agencies including global brands such as NTT Communications, Comcast, Dell, Investec, Rackspace, Red Hat, Mozilla, VMware, H&R Block and Vodafone. With its vibrant open source community and worldwide partner network, Zimbra is the third largest collaboration provider in the world. Zimbra is privately held with corporate headquarters in Frisco, Texas and offices in San Mateo, California; London; Tokyo; Singapore and Pune, India.
